Abstract

We construct the general vortex solution in the color-flavor-locked vacuum of a non-Abelian gauge theory, where the gauge group is taken to be the product of an arbitrary simple group and U (1). Use of the holomorphic invariants allows us to extend the moduli-matrix method and to determine the vortex moduli space in all cases. Our approach provides a new framework for studying solitons of non-Abelian varieties with various possible applications in physics.
